Solution for 25u^2-4u=0 equation:



25u^2-4u=0
a = 25; b = -4; c = 0;
Δ = b2-4ac
Δ = -42-4·25·0
Δ = 16
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$u_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$u_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

$\sqrt{\Delta}=\sqrt{16}=4$
$u_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-4)-4}{2*25}=\frac{0}{50} =0 $
$u_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-4)+4}{2*25}=\frac{8}{50} =4/25 $
